Police in Bauchi State have detained an 18-year-old pregnant housewife who is accused of killing her 5-year-old stepdaughter for defecating on her.
Auwal Muhammad, the commissioner of police for the state of Bauchi, said this on Tuesday when presenting the suspect to reporters at the command center.
He claimed that the suspect, Khadija Adamu, was detained after inflicting grievous wounds on the child. Adamu is a resident of the Kandahar region, a suburb of the city of Bauchi in Bauchi State.
“On September 28, 2023, at approximately 9.25 p.m., one Abdulaziz Adamu, male (38), of the Kandahar area of Bauchi, reported at the A’ Divisional Police Headquarters that on September 28, 2023, at approximately 4 p.m., one Khadija Adamu, female (18), of the same address, beat up her stepdaughter named Hafsat Garba, female (five), resulting in serious injuries to her body. After learning of the incident, a group of detectives under the direction of DPO sprung into action, hurried to the spot, and transported the woman to the Abubakar Tafawa Balewa University Teaching Hospital in Bauchi, where the doctor certified her dead.
According to the preliminary investigation, the victim was beaten up by the suspect after it was claimed that she had passed stool on her clothes, ruining them, and as a result, she had varying degrees of injuries across her body.
He claimed that during questioning, the suspect “confessed to the alleged offense against her without much argument,” adding that the investigation is still ongoing and that the suspect will thereafter be charged in court for the established criminal as appropriate.
